Weekly Current Affairs
  • India’s GDP grew by 7.8% in Q4 FY26, driving the full-year FY26 economic growth revision upward to 7.7% due to strong performance in services and construction.
  • West Bengal signed an MoU to join Ayushman Bharat PM-JAY scheme, becoming the 36th State/UT, with rollout beginning in July 2026 benefiting around 6 crore families.
  • Union Minister Piyush Goyal launched the BHAVYA Portal to implement a flagship scheme for developing 100 world-class industrial parks across India with an outlay of ₹33,660 crore.
  • India ranked fifth globally in military spending for 2025 with an expenditure of $92.1 billion and remained the world's second-largest arms importer during 2021–25.
  • Assam, Nagaland, and Centre signed a tripartite MoU for oil and gas exploration in disputed border fields with 50:50 revenue sharing.
  • India announced a $2.5 million contribution to UNRWA for Palestine refugees.
